The internet records everything. Every click, every post, every purchase leaves a digital trail that can haunt you for years to come. But what if you could remove yourself from the web entirely? It's not as challenging as you might think. With some planning and effort, you can vanish into the ether, leaving no trace of your online presence behind. Start by locating all the platforms where you have an account – social media – and begin the process of deleting them one by one.
Next, search online for any data points that might still be accessible. Leverage search engines and specialized tools to uncover anything you've shared. Once you've located all the relevant information, contact the websites or platforms personally to request its removal. Be persistent, polite, and meticulous in your efforts.
- Consider that fully deleting yourself from the web is a complex endeavor. It takes time, effort, and a willingness to diligently scrub away every piece of your online history.
